AerationA Year-Round Lawn Care Program for Lasting Results
Healthy lawns are built through consistent care throughout the seasons. Our comprehensive lawn care program includes spring fertilization, weed control, summer soil conditioning, fall aeration and overseeding, and winter nutrient applications to keep your lawn strong year-round. By following a proven treatment schedule, Southeastern Pa homeowners can enjoy a thicker, greener, and more resilient lawn that stands out in every season.
List of Services
-
March – Spring KickoffList Item 1
Services Provided:
Pre-Emergent Crabgrass Control
Slow-Release Fertilizer Application
Lawn Evaluation
Benefits:
Stops crabgrass before it germinates while providing essential nutrients to wake your lawn from winter dormancy.
-
April – Broadleaf Weed ControlList Item 2
Services Provided: Spot Treatment & Broadleaf Weed Control Lawn Inspection Benefits: Targets dandelions, clover, chickweed, and other early-season weeds before they spread.
-
May – Weed Control & Turf InspectionList Item 3
Services Provided:
Broadleaf Weed Control
Spot Treatment of Problem Areas
Benefits:
Keeps weeds under control during peak spring growth and promotes a cleaner, healthier lawn.
-
June – Organic Fertilizer & Weed ControlList Item 4
Services Provided:
Organic-Based Fertilizer Application
Weed Control Treatment
Benefits:
Feeds the lawn naturally while maintaining weed suppression and encouraging deeper root growth.
-
July – Summer Weed Control
Services Provided:
Spot Weed Control
Mid-Summer Lawn Evaluation
Benefits:
Controls summer weeds while minimizing stress on the turf during hot weather.
-
August – Soil Conditioning & Weed Control
Services Provided:
Soil Conditioner Application
Humic Acid / Biochar Soil Enhancement
Spot Weed Control
Benefits:
Improves soil structure, nutrient availability, moisture retention, and overall turf health.
-
September – Fall Renovation Service
Services Provided:
Core Aeration
Premium Tall Fescue Overseeding
Starter Fertilizer
Benefits:
Relieves soil compaction, thickens the lawn, repairs summer damage, and establishes new grass before winter.
-
October – Organic Fall Fertilizer
Services Provided:
Organic Fertilizer Application
Benefits:
Strengthens roots and stores nutrients for a healthier lawn next spring.
-
December – Winterizer Fertilizer
Services Provided:
Winter Fertilizer Application
Benefits:
Provides essential nutrients that are stored in the root system during winter, resulting in earlier green-up and stronger spring growth.
